Level Up with PowerCup - Campaign Concept

A small creative team, myself included, were briefed to create a concept for PowerCup. The goal was to drive sales in retail stores as well as appeal to a younger audience - from child to teen.
The first part of the process prior to this brief was to rethink the overall creative look and feel of PowerCup and how the visuals will be executed.

Concept Phase

Kids are known for having big imaginations and therefore they see the world differently. Power Cup should express that feeling of fun in a kids day to day.

In this concept we show how Power gives kids the little boost and flavor to get through the day while inspiring their imaginations. We will show kids bringing the energy of power cup with them wherever they go as a bright imaginative world forms around them.

Example:
A kid walks into a spaza shop and grabs his favourite flavor of Power Cup out the fridge, as he does this everything around him starts changing and everything he touches becomes a fun, colourful and surreal world representing the imagination of a child.

This will help us re-explore and justify the idea of “Taste Fun” to make it more believable for our audience
The Campaign Idea

A campaign and competition that brings the fun of video games to the real world. 

Using visuals inspired from famous video game genres in an illustrated, 16-bit style, we bring the world of imagination into the realm of the digital worlds created for fun.

Video Games were created for the sole purpose of bringing fun into people’s homes, and since their inception have turned into a multi-billion dollar industry. 

Power Cup let’s people taste fun, now it’s time for us to take that fun to the next level.

Level Up your Fun with Power Cup 
Key Visual Direction & Rational

A kid in an vibrant street that feels slightly surreal but still has the the look 
of a typical urban street in South Africa.

The kid will be excited, holding a power cup in one hand and a game
controller/console in the other.

Around him we can see illustrated pixel-like video game elements that give us the illusion that the video games are coming to life - this takes inspiration from our ‘World of Imagination’ concept.
